Why the 2013 World Series Was So Special

The 2013 World Series was more than just a championship; it was a narrative of healing and unity for the city of Boston. Just months after the Boston Marathon bombing, the Red Sox provided a much-needed source of inspiration and hope. The team, filled with gritty players and led by a rookie manager, John Farrell, defied expectations and captured the hearts of fans worldwide.

From Worst to First: A Season of Redemption

Coming off a disastrous 2012 season, where they finished in last place, expectations were low. However, the team underwent a significant transformation, bringing in new faces like Mike Napoli, Shane Victorino, and Koji Uehara. These players, combined with veterans like David Ortiz and Dustin Pedroia, created a clubhouse culture of camaraderie and determination. The mantra of the season became "Boston Strong," a rallying cry that resonated throughout the city and beyond.

The regular season saw the Red Sox surge to the top of the American League East, finishing with a 97-65 record. Key moments included a 12-game winning streak in July and August, showcasing their ability to dominate opponents. The team's offense was potent, led by Ortiz's clutch hitting and Napoli's power. The pitching staff, anchored by Jon Lester and Clay Buchholz, provided consistency and depth.

The Postseason Run: Improbable and Unforgettable

The playoffs were nothing short of dramatic. In the ALDS, the Red Sox faced the Tampa Bay Rays, winning the series in four games. The ALCS pitted them against the Detroit Tigers, a team boasting a formidable pitching rotation led by Justin Verlander and Max Scherzer. After falling behind 1-0, the Red Sox rallied, winning the series in six games, highlighted by Ortiz's iconic grand slam in Game 2 at Fenway Park. That moment, with Ortiz rounding the bases and Torii Hunter flipping over the bullpen fence, remains etched in the memories of Red Sox fans.

The World Series against the St. Louis Cardinals was a back-and-forth affair. The Red Sox ultimately prevailed in six games, clinching the championship at Fenway Park for the first time since 1918. The final out, a ground ball to Mike Napoli, set off a wild celebration, with players mobbing the mound and fans erupting in jubilation. The victory was a testament to the team's resilience and a symbol of Boston's strength.

The Emotional Impact: More Than Just a Game

The 2013 World Series title was more than just a sporting achievement; it was a healing moment for a city scarred by tragedy. The Red Sox dedicated their season to the victims of the Boston Marathon bombing, visiting hospitals, attending memorial services, and wearing "Boston Strong" patches on their uniforms. The team's success provided a sense of unity and hope, reminding everyone that even in the face of adversity, Boston could persevere. How to Spot a Genuine 2013 World Series Shirt

For collectors and fans alike, owning an authentic Red Sox 2013 World Series shirt is a badge of honor. However, the market is flooded with replicas and fakes, making it essential to know how to distinguish a genuine article from a counterfeit. Here’s a comprehensive guide to help you spot the real deal.

Check the Tags and Labels: The Devil Is in the Details

One of the first things to examine is the shirt's tags and labels. Authentic Red Sox 2013 World Series shirts will have high-quality tags that are securely attached and feature clear, legible printing. Look for the official MLB logo on the tags, as well as the manufacturer's logo (e.g., Majestic, Nike, or Adidas). Counterfeit shirts often have tags that are poorly printed, misaligned, or made from cheap materials.

The labels should also include information about the shirt's fabric content and care instructions. Genuine shirts will typically be made from high-quality cotton or a cotton blend, and the labels will accurately reflect this. Check for any misspellings or grammatical errors on the labels, as these are common indicators of a fake. Additionally, make sure the size indicated on the label matches the actual size of the shirt.

Examine the Stitching and Construction: Quality Matters

Another key indicator of authenticity is the quality of the stitching and construction. Authentic Red Sox 2013 World Series shirts will have clean, even stitching throughout. Look for tight, secure seams that are free from loose threads or fraying. The collar, sleeves, and hem should be neatly finished, with no signs of sloppy workmanship.

Counterfeit shirts often have poor-quality stitching, with uneven seams, loose threads, and a general lack of attention to detail. The fabric may also be thin and flimsy, and the overall construction may feel cheap and poorly made. Pay close attention to the areas around the logos and graphics, as these are often the first places where counterfeiters cut corners.

Authenticity of Logos and Graphics: Precision Is Key

The logos and graphics on a Red Sox 2013 World Series shirt should be sharp, clear, and accurately reproduced. Look for vibrant colors, clean lines, and precise detailing. The official World Series logo, the Red Sox logo, and any other graphics should be faithfully replicated, with no distortions or imperfections.

Counterfeit shirts often have logos and graphics that are blurry, pixelated, or poorly aligned. The colors may be off, and the details may be missing or distorted. Check for any signs of bleeding or fading, as these are common indicators of a fake. Additionally, make sure the logos and graphics are properly positioned on the shirt and that they are the correct size and scale.

Caring for Your Collectible Shirt

So, you've finally got your hands on that prized Red Sox 2013 World Series shirt. Now what? Proper care is essential to preserve its condition and value for years to come. Here’s how to keep your collectible shirt looking its best.

Washing Instructions: Gentle Is Key

When it comes to washing your Red Sox 2013 World Series shirt, gentle is key. Avoid harsh detergents and hot water, as these can damage the fabric and fade the colors. Instead, opt for a mild detergent and cold water. Turn the shirt inside out before washing to protect the logos and graphics.

Consider hand-washing your shirt, especially if it's a vintage or delicate item. Fill a basin with cold water and add a small amount of mild detergent. Gently agitate the shirt in the water, and then rinse thoroughly. Avoid wringing or twisting the shirt, as this can stretch or damage the fabric. If you prefer to use a washing machine, select the delicate cycle and place the shirt in a mesh laundry bag for added protection.

Drying Tips: Air Dry Is Best

The best way to dry your Red Sox 2013 World Series shirt is to air dry it. Avoid using a dryer, as the high heat can shrink the fabric and damage the logos and graphics. Instead, hang the shirt on a clothesline or lay it flat on a clean surface to air dry. If you must use a dryer, select the lowest heat setting and remove the shirt as soon as it's dry.

To prevent wrinkles, smooth out the shirt while it's still damp and hang it on a hanger. Avoid hanging the shirt in direct sunlight, as this can cause the colors to fade. If you're storing the shirt for an extended period of time, consider placing it in a garment bag to protect it from dust and moisture.

Storing Your Shirt: Keep It Safe and Sound

Proper storage is essential to preserve the condition of your Red Sox 2013 World Series shirt. Avoid storing the shirt in a damp or humid environment, as this can lead to mold and mildew growth. Instead, choose a cool, dry place, such as a closet or storage container.

Fold the shirt neatly and store it in a garment bag or acid-free paper to protect it from dust and light. Avoid storing the shirt in a plastic bag, as this can trap moisture and cause the fabric to deteriorate. If you're displaying the shirt, consider framing it or placing it in a display case to protect it from damage.
